Boom, Butterfly Effect
I was 8 years late to the party for Until Dawn but it was worth it.
For a start the visuals haven't aged a bit, the lighting is stunning and the facial animations are still better than most games you see now. The only awkward moments are in the physical animations where it something as simple as opening a door looks janky and off, that's a very minor blip though.

The gameplay at its core is pretty basic with lots of walking, QTEs and dialogue choices. What makes it stand out however is the atmosphere and pressure the game layers on it, you're eased into it at the start with mundane tasks but by the end every button press and choice could mean death and shiz gets tense. This is especially true of the "Don't move" segments, I thought it would be easy but boy that mechanic is both genius and nasty especially in the closing moments. The walking segments do go on a bit long and can take away from the replay value.
I'm usually put off by games heavily dependent on choices (thanks to the Walking Dead games) but here the game does a good job of laying out which paths lay before you in terms of character relationships, there's also the totems to guide you which helped me out in a few tense moments. The Run or Hide bits are much more 50/50 and you're likely going to fail a couple on your first run.

The story is clever and engaging once it gets going, the characters are all your pretty typical teenage archetypes but props to the writer though for swaying my views on Mike and Jessica who I first thought were the annoying jock and cheerleader combo but actually I grew to like them alot by the end. The plot does get wonky towards the end as the game thinks of reasons to get the guys out of the lodge then back to the lodge to set up for the big finale. The story is also incredibly grim, discovering the fate of certain characters wasn't something I was able to shake straight away and when you do mess up and get people killed you get very creatively violent deaths to an almost disturbing degree.
A warning too if you don't like jumpscares as there are plenty of them throughout but they are mostly fake-out ones to keep you on edge.

At about 7 hours long per run it's definitely worth a go, the studio has made other games with the same formula but most would agree that they captured something special in this first attempt.

Damn solid story/atmosphere, room for improvement on the "gameplay"
Until Dawn first impressions review

I went into this game mostly blind, all I knew was that it was a choice based telltale-esque game that was more so a movie with player dependent choices/actions than a standard video game experience - and that it featured Wendigos. I'm very glad I went in blind, because that's how this game is meant to be played.

Now, I've only played the game once - and finished it less than 30 minutes before writing this review - and I understand this is a game that will greatly benefit from a replay, so this review is mostly first impressions.

This "game" tells a very very compelling horror narrative. It is DECEPTIVELY CORNY at first, resembling what could initially be written off as a parody of slashers - asshole horny teenagers and a killer on the loose. Once you get past that stage though, you get involved in a touching narrative about grief, growing as a person, good and bad decisions, and the fact that sometimes you can't save everyone no matter how much it hurts to realize that.

The characters and their individual arcs are well written, people who seem like insensitive assholes reveal parts of their truer self under pressure, the sensitive parts of our ego that we tend to hide are unmasked and they learn that sometimes it's okay to be scared, and that there will be people there for you. People learn what grief can do to a person's mind, and how corrupt a mind can become when it becomes controlled by its own delusional narratives.

As for the horror? It's quite suspenseful once you start getting to the "meat" of the game and stays that way all the way through, there's a few moments where you have to suspend your disbelief to a degree, but once you get past that you begin to feel embedded in the tense thrills it presents you. There are a few instances of jumpscares, but I feel they're decently earned.

As for the gameplay, I do think there's a lot of room for improvement. Sometimes it feels like the quick time events (which there are a lot of and man I get the circle and square buttons confused too often out of pressure) and "DON'T MOVE" sections are a bit too abrupt, especially the latter when it literally can mean life or death, but the actual use of the choice based narrative is quite well done and feels genuine. One thing I will say, the movement controls are ATROCIOUSLY CLUNKY and THANK GOD there isn't any real punishment for being slow to move in those sections. The controls just did not mix well with the camera style.

But overall, it's was a great experience and I'm glad I played it and I probably will eventually replay it again with hindsight in mind.

Gameplay: 5/10
Story: 9/10
Character writing: 8/10
Atmosphere/Presentation/Horror: 8/10
Overall: 8/10 would recommend if you enjoy suspense/horror media

Enjoyable tribute to shitty slashers movies
I had low expectations for this game after looking at the reviews and ratings online, but I shall say that this is actually quite a good example of interactive drama. You shouldn't be too serious while playing this: after all "Until Dawn" is nothing but a big tribute to the cheap slasher horror movies. All the clichés of the genre are here, and I played it the same way I would watch a shitty horror movie on Friday night, just for the sake of having fun. Never expect a deep narrative, everything is over the top and straightforward enough to keep the attention going.

Like in other similar story-driven titles, the gameplay is simple and minimal, but knowing that each mistake might permanently kill one of the characters will keep the tension high even for the simplest actions. Characters are again a bunch of slasher movie archetypes but are so easy to love or hate to the point you will feel frustrated every time you end up "killing" each one of them.

The only problem was the shift of genre during the second half with the wendigos. It just made the whole thing kind of uninteresting compared to the first few chapters. I didn't mind the game being not as dependent on the player's choice as advertised, but as I was expecting to play a slasher, I was kind of disappointed to have to deal with monsters and supernatural BS for half of the game.

It's bizarre to see this release get such glowing reviews from critics. I can't think of a more basic horror game with such mass appeal. I got this via PSN+ for free, and I finished it last night. I do enjoy the consequence of having characters die based on my bad inputs (killed Matt for not hitting the right button) and it seemed to change the story a bit. The Butterfly Effect is nice, but it's potential is still there. It's not properly put to use, often having you say to yourself, "I'll have to play through this again to see the other effect."

From the performances, jump scares, writing, and logic, "Until Dawn" suffers on many fronts. I am very particular when it comes to horror, but I don't think it's a lot to say that the horror here feels like it came out of a film production company like BlumHouse. The scares are cheap, the characters are aggravating, and it's a drag to get through. Admittedly, there are a few moments I did enjoy. I did, also, want to see it through to the end, so it couldn't have been that bad.

In short, "Until Dawn," is what happens when films such as "The Conjuring," do well; someone feels the need to put it into a game. There are plenty of unrecognized horror experiences out there that should get the praise the game still, to this day, gets.

I remember seeing this game about a year before it came out and seeing it advertised as a Heavy Rain style game where your choices impacted the outcome of the game, and it would be done in the style of a cliche horror movie. It vaguely interested me, as it claimed you could have characters die if you make the wrong choices and the ending would actually reflect this, which is a step up from most of the Telltale games where no matter what choices you make the ending will almost always be the same. I ended up renting this through Gamefly a few weeks before Halloween through a free trial I had about 2 years back. To be honest, for the first half of the game I found it pretty entertaining and engaging. It did come off as a bit cheesy with some awkward dialogue, but it had a nice murder mystery going, and was full of some really tense moments, and I actually felt like my choices in the game were making a difference plus I was enjoying the environment, and the graphics in this game are excellent, some of the better I've seen on PS4. But then about halfway through the game changes its focus and tone, and goes from being a psycho killer murder mystery, to a supernatural horror with monsters.

It just felt really odd and abrupt how the game shifted, and I found the second half of the game to be way less interesting. It just felt like most of the second half was running away from monsters. Plus some characters in this game have plot armor and just can't die until the final chapter, which is stupid because theres one point where a character is attacked by tons of monsters and if you fail that segment he just gets knocked out until he's rescued. But overall, the game isn't bad, it was fun collecting totems and making choices that could be risky and kill off characters, and up until the big plot twist, the game was an enjoyable horror thriller that kept me captivated. The game just got a bit ridiculous and went a bit downhill in the second half with less good moments and lame generic monsters. Plus the ending doesn't really change much, the helicopter will still arrive to rescue everyone, the only different is the more characters you save the more interviews show during the credits. Also did I mention some of the characters in this game are just super awkward and annoying that its like the game purposely wants you to hate them. This game still is worth playing one time at least, maybe 2 if you want to save all the characters and get the collectibles, but it still has some pretty glaring flaws, and a story that starts falling apart in the second half, plus some characters that have plot armor, I mean if it would have just stuck to the murder mystery with a psychotic killer and given more points where characters could be killed off, this could have been a lot better.

    Never got why the general opinion was positive. It's totally confused about weather it wants to be a satire or not (the Cabin on the Woods movie being very similar pulls off the switch from fake danger to real danger leagues more smoothly) and wastes time baiting threads that will end up not adding much to the overall story. Also, for an exploration game the more you explore the more you realize how lazy the choice system is, not that unlike David Cage games where straying away from the intended path leads to a nonsensical story, and on top big sections of the game are unfailable (Sam and Mike cannot die until their last scene in the game).
